Abstract

The invention discloses a device and method for one-time pouring molding of an ultra-high concrete column. The device comprises a guiding device arranged in an ultra-high concrete column formwork. The guiding device comprises a collecting hopper, a scissor fork lifting mechanism, guiding pipe connecting mechanisms and a guiding pipe. The collecting hopper is arranged on the top of the guiding pipe, the guiding pipe is divided into multiple sections with the equal length, the sections are connected through the guiding pipe connecting mechanisms, the lower portion of the collecting hopper is sleeved with the scissor fork type lifting mechanism for lifting the guiding pipe, multiple vibrating rods for vibrating and densifying concrete are arranged between hoops on the edges of the formwork, multiple sections of scale marks are arranged on the vibrating rods, and the length of each section of scale mark is equal to that of each section of guiding pipe. Coincidence and integrity with the concrete are guaranteed, the honeycomb and scale phenomenon caused by the fact that vibration is not in place is avoided, the structural safety and appearance quality of one-time molding of the ultra-high reinforced concrete structure column are guaranteed accordingly, appearance attractiveness is improved, and the construction period is shortened.

Description

technical field [0001] The invention relates to the field of building construction, in particular to a device and method for one-time pouring and forming of super-high concrete columns. Background technique [0002] The pouring and forming of super-high concrete columns is a major difficulty in the construction control of concrete structures. The concrete column of a large factory building in a logistics center in Guangdong is 9 meters high on the first floor, and the concrete column on the second floor is 14 meters high. And the on-site concrete columns are fair-faced concrete columns, which have higher requirements on the appearance of one-time molding. [0003] If segmental pouring is adopted, it is easy to have a staggered platform between the upper and lower columns, and at the same time, the construction process time is prolonged, which cannot meet the construction period requirements.
